Now it was to be sure it was Ofenberg did not say that Klopman had
written any thing about me but he did say that the Duke had, and I should
imagine the Duke must have consulted with Klopman about it.
Upon the whole I dont much like this letter, perhaps Klopman in the
midst of the bustle he Mittau must be in at present forgot my
name & all about it. You know I suppose by the papers that the
Duke actually has or is just upon the point of taking to him
a 3d wife. He has been married these 3 weeks. I hope theose rejoicings are over by this time.

If this letter of K's should make you think with of Courland with less
expectations, be assured that with respect to Russia my expectations are
greater than they were. I dont like at all to find that there ar
no ers for me at Mittau. This is a very great disappointment lett
my ony hopes now are that on some account or other you have y
to direct your letters and to Liban instead. I hope to be at
Liban tomorrow or if I should find reason to stay here a second day
then at furthest the day after tomorrow I hope to find
my letters. There is a great deal of money to be got in the -by Shipbuilding
in these Northern Countries at this time. Can it be impossible
that I should be able to come in for a little.

I staid but one day at Koningsberg in which I picked up a good
deal of information. I was proof against the temptation which
I had to stay longer by adresses messages at least of introduction to
8 or 10 in short to all the Nobility about the place.

I dont recollect having spent more than 3 days idle since I lef Hanburg. those were at Schwedt
